Output 948d27c6d71c698dfcbfbc4da19745c9c24b52fc46b27225a33b5e25caab1b3a:0

value
40275292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52ed69acb261c2f8e9369b648ee41dd9a5a0ee7 OP_EQUAL
address
MRsmTbvLsR6BrLuzYg8xwTNuCZdVhewJxu
transaction
948d27c6d71c698dfcbfbc4da19745c9c24b52fc46b27225a33b5e25caab1b3a
spent
true